merry
adjective: If you describe someone's character or behaviour as merry, you mean that they are happy and cheerful.

merry in American English
full of fun and laughter; lively and cheerful
adjective: full of cheerfulness or gaiety; joyous in disposition or spirit
noun: a female given name

merry in British English
adjective: cheerful; jolly
